[2010] The Greatest Name of Allāh – By حفظه الله. Khutbah at Masjid As-Salafi, Birmingham, UK.

Some points discussed during this Khutbah:

⁃ A mention of false claims and fabricated narrations regarding the Greatest Name of Allāh.
⁃ A weak narration attributed to the Tafsīr of the statement of Allāh, “They followed what the Shayaṭīn (devils) gave out (falsely of the magic) in the lifetime of Sulaymān (Solomon). Sulaymān did not disbelieve, but the Shayaṭīn (devils) disbelieved, teaching men magic and such things that came down at Babylon to the two angels, Hārūt and Marūt…” [Sūrah al-Baqarah 2:102]
⁃ Four positions from the People of Knowledge regarding the Greatest Name of Allāh, and the proof used for each position.
⁃ A discussion by Ibn al-Qayyim (رحمه الله) on why the Greatest Name of Allāh is not one definitive, unchanging Name but is relative to the condition and need of the servant when he is calling upon Allāh.
⁃ A mention of the Names of Allāh relative to the servant based on his condition:
⁃ poverty and need
⁃ weakness
⁃ humility
⁃ regret
⁃ seeking sustenance
⁃ a state of ignorance and seeking correct guidance and understanding
⁃ when on the battlefield
⁃ The great importance of having knowledge of the Names and Attributes of Allāh.
